Product Description
Chinchillas make excellent animal companions for someone who is looking for a more advanced pet. As an active animal, chinchillas have special requirements such as cooler temperatures and a larger habitat with multiple levels. Chinchillas can live together and learn to be handled with care. They are available in a variety of colors and have a long life span of at least 10 years.
- Life Expectancy 10 - 20 years.
- Max Size 9 - 14 inches ; 1 - 1.75 lbs
Feeding Instructions
Daily provide chinchillas with fresh water, Timothy hay, and food specifically formulated for chinchillas.
Habitat and Care
Habitat and Care
Chinchillas require a habitat that is well ventilated and has multiple levels for them to climb about. The habitat should be at least 4x3x3. As an advanced level animal, chinchillas need to be kept in cooler conditions and a quiet setting. To help keep their coat and skin healthy, Chinchillas should never get wet but instead be offered a weekly dust bath with commercially available dust specifically for them. Chews that are safe should be provided at all times to help keep their teeth from over growing. Spot clean their cage daily and deep clean once a week. Hay, food and clean water should be available at all times.
